this is the main branch.. it might be unstable here lol IF YOU WANT THE STABLE VERSION, GO TO THE STABLE BRANCH!
Command line radio for browsing and playing internet stations from your terminal. Powered by the Radio Browser API.
Tested on: Debian Testing, Arch Linux, Windows 10, Ubuntu 24.04.4 LTS and Termux on Android
- Lightweight Node.js CLI
- Interactive usage (no arguments)
- Stream playback via
mpv
- Windows, Linux (recommended), or macOS
- Node.js v25.8.1
mpvinstalled and in your PATH
npm install -g .clio- Type a station name (example:
soma fm) - Or use
tag:ambientto search by tag - Enter a result number to play
- Type
qto quit
Clio discovers a working API server at startup using all.api.radio-browser.info. The project uses the official endpoints and registers clicks when you play a station.